Useful Cisco IOS Commands - Switching Modules

The show module command provides information that is useful in solving problems with ports on individual
modules.
Some problems can be solved by resetting the switching module. Power cycle the chassis - this resets, restarts,
and power cycles the switching module.

Troubleshooting Supervisor Modules

This section only addresses problems with hardware. Problems with features or configuration are not covered
here. Refer for your software configuration guide and release notes for information on configuring features
or identifying known problems.
